Fermo (inhabited place) |
Coordinates: |
Lat: 43 09 00 N degrees minutes |
Lat: 43.1500 decimal degrees |
Long: 013 43 00 E degrees minutes |
Long: 13.7167 decimal degrees |
|
Elevation: |
1046.587 feet |
319.0000 meters |
|
Note: Located on hill above Tenna river near Adriatic Sea; first inhabited by Picene people; taken by Romans in 264 BCE; conquered by Goths, Byzantines (553 CE), Lombards & Franks; ruled by papacy 8th-9th cen. & from 1549. |
